Lost Boy –
I booked the two day Tour, day one at Xcaret and day two at Xplor. As a part of the package, we were provided round-trip transportation to and from the park to our resort. The park contacted my through my email to schedule a pick-up time. My ticket to Xcaret included access to lockers and lunch. This was very valuable because we had a location to keep our dry clothes when not in the river, and the buffet lunch would have cost us an additional $30 dollars per person. The food was delicious! There are other places to eat in the park, but I didn’t take advantage of any of these.
I would suggest waiting to walk the river and caves during the heat of the day in the afternoon. There are two caves to follow and I wish I had taken advantage of walking/swimming both of them. The shows in the late afternoon are worth the time, if you can visit the rest of the park before they start. DON’T miss the Spectacular in the evening! The show is amazing and a wonderful tribute to the Mexican history and culture. I was a bit tired after a long day of walking in the hot sun to sit in a large arena on a thin padded seat with no air conditioning, but the entertainment was worth the time. Everyone was required to wear a mask but social distancing was not enforced
Xplor was an amazing park, and was surprised to see that many of the trails between the activities was under ground surrounded with stalagmites and stalagtites. My favorite activity was the Zip-line because the scenery was beautiful and a few of the runs picked up quite a bit of speed. They do ensure your safety, but be sure to follow their rules. I put my feet down at the end of one fast run and slammed my feet to the floor, bruising my feet.
I wore river shoes throughout the entire park and I wouldn’t recommend anything else. You run into water everywhere. Most activities I could do twice because I arrived early to the park and stayed until 4pm before the Xflor Fuego group came in. The buffet at Xplor was really good and the BBQ Ribs was my favorite. Lunch was included in the price. Bring your own towel. Lockers were provided. The crew that picks you up will help you locate your driver after the tour is over. We were picked up from our hotel at 7:30 and then we left the park at 4 or so, which gave us plenty of time to do most activities twice at an easy pace.
I would purchase this package again.

Pao R –
Xcaret is an amazing place, a definite must-do for any tourist visiting the Cancun area. This place is a well designed nature/eco-tourism theme park. Mexicans have done a great job building this place they should be very proud it is a highlight in any vacation to the country. In addition to the 50 or so attractions the park offers for the entrance fee, we also chose 3 optional adventure activities that sent our trip here over the top! We got to swim and interact with sting rays, walk underwater wearing diving bells(Sea Trek), and we rode in the speed boat Adrenalina(best water ride ever!). Overall our one day trip here was very enjoyable and memorable.
